What is Reactive Maintenance?

Reactive maintenance is the opposite of preventative maintenance and mainly involves responding to issues as and when they emerge, including random breakdowns or equipment failures. Even with sufficient preventative maintenance, accidents and faults might still happen and require a rapid response.

What is Building Fabric Maintenance?

To put it simply, building fabric maintenance is the process of managing any ongoing repairs and maintenance of a building’s structural features. The answer to 'what is fabric maintenance?' Includes assets, but not any mechanical and electrical work.
